1VK5
X-ray Structure of Gene Product from Arabidopsis Thaliana At3g22680
Experimental procedure
Experimental method | SINGLE WAVELENGTH |
Source type | SYNCHROTRON |
Source details | APS BEAMLINE 14-BM-D |
Synchrotron site | APS |
Beamline | 14-BM-D |
Temperature [K] | 100 |
Detector technology | CCD |
Collection date | 2004-02-14 |
Detector | ADSC QUANTUM 4 |
Wavelength(s) | 0.9790 |
Spacegroup name | P 31 2 1 |
Unit cell lengths | 83.450, 83.450, 60.575 |
Unit cell angles | 90.00, 90.00, 120.00 |
Refinement procedure
Resolution | 34.300 - 1.604 |
R-factor | 0.16102 |
Rwork | 0.160 |
R-free | 0.18350 |
Structure solution method | MAD |
RMSD bond length | 0.019 |
RMSD bond angle | 1.646 |
Data reduction software | DENZO |
Data scaling software | SCALEPACK |
Phasing software | SOLVE (2.05) |
Refinement software | REFMAC (refmac_5.1.24) |
Data quality characteristics
Overall | Inner shell | Outer shell | |
Low resolution limit [Å] | 50.000 | 50.000 | 1.660 |
High resolution limit [Å] | 1.600 | 3.450 | 1.600 |
Rmerge | 0.037 | 0.021 | 0.302 |
Number of reflections | 32231 | ||
<I/σ(I)> | 38.61 | 9.3 | |
Completeness [%] | 99.2 | 99.8 | 92.2 |
Redundancy | 10.9 | 10.4 |
Crystallization Conditions
crystal ID | method | pH | temperature | details |
1 | VAPOR DIFFUSION, HANGING DROP | 8.5 | 293 | protein (10 mg/ml), Ammonium Sulfate (0.8M), Hepes (0.1M), Magnesium Sulfate (0.04M), CHAPS (0.41%), pH 8.5, Vapor diffusion, hanging drop, temperature 293K |
2 | VAPOR DIFFUSION, HANGING DROP | 8.5 | 293 | protein (5 mg/ml), Ammonium Sulfate (0.8M), Hepes (0.1M), Magnesium Sulfate (0.04M), CHAPS (0.41%), pH 8.5, Vapor diffusion, hanging drop, temperature 293K |
